UPDATE: New wildfire in Central Okanagan
UPDATE: 5:00 p.m.
The Jack Creek fire west of Glenrosa in West Kelowna is estimated at 7.3 hectares and classified as out of control.
There are 19 personnel and helicopters actioning the fire.
Seventeen properties on Maxwell Road are on evacuation alert, north of the Okanagan Connector Highway 97-C/Trepanier Road access.
The cause of the fire is believed to be lightning.

B.C. Wildfire crews are attacking a new blaze from the ground and air west of Glenrosa Road in West Kelowna between Trepanier and the ski club.
The Jack Creek fire is estimated at 4.5 hectares and is suspected to have been caused by lightning.

Ten firefighters were on the ground Wednesday evening.
Helicopters and air tankers did what they could before it got dark.
